Some other stuff jazz stuff today:
Web Web/Max Herre - with Brandee Younger, Yusef Lateef, and others -- listened this morning, first listen was great, eager to dive in deeper

Kenny Garrett - Sounds from the Ancestors - a few tracks were a little too smoothed out but most of this was super solid. Took me a minute to find anything about the lineup so sharing here for anyone interested, from Glide magazine:
"The core ensemble for the recording are the same musicians who accompanied him at Newport augmented by guests. The core group is pianist Vernell Brown, Jr., bassist Corcoran Holt, drummer Ronald Bruner, and percussionist Rudy Bird. Guests include drummer Lenny White, pianist and organist Johnny Mercier, trumpeter Maurice Brown, conquero Peditro Martinez, bata percussionist Dreiser Durruthy, and singers Dwight Trible, Jean Baylor, Linny Smith, Chris Ashley Anthony and Sheherazade Holman. Garrett sings on two tracks, plays electric piano on four, and does a piano intro and outro on the title track."
